Ephedra alkaloids (ephedrine and pseudoephedrine) may cause psychosis and it appears that their effects may be exaggerated by an interaction with caffeine and alcohol. Experimental evidence In a study, rats were given an oral solution of ephedra (containing up to 50 mg/kg ephedrine) with, and without, caffeine. Ephedra with caffeine increased the clinical signs of toxicity (salivation, hyperactivity, ataxia, lethargy, failure to respond to stimuli) in the treated rats, when compared with ephedra alone. Histological analysis for cardiotoxicity showed some evidence of haemorrhage, necrosis, and tissue degeneration within 2 to 4 hours of treatment. No statistical difference in the occurrence of cardiotoxic lesions was found when animals treated with ephedrine were compared with those treated with ephedra, indicating that the cardiotoxic effects of ephedra are due to ephedrine. The extract also enhanced the relaxation caused by sildenafil, tadalafil and vardenafil. In vitro, an extract of Epimedium brevicornum and one of its constituents, icariin, have been found to inhibit phosphodiesterase type-5, although both had weaker effects than sildenafil. Nevertheless, the concurrent use of epimedium and a phosphodiesterase type-5 inhibitor could potentially lead to additive effects, which may be beneficial, but which could in theory also lead to adverse effects, such as priapism. It would therefore seem prudent to discuss concurrent use with patients, and warn them of the potential risks. Note that it is generally recommended that other agents for erectile dysfunction should be avoided in those taking sildenafil, tadalafil or vardenafil. Here we examine the chemical features of the signals and what that suggests about activity requirements, their location(s) in the host plant, and the possible relevance of the chemical and spatial diversity of the signals. The ability of Agrobacterium to recognize and respond to seemingly all dicotyledonous plants must underpin the success of this multi-host pathogen. For example, while the phenol is necessary and sufficient for VirA/VirG activation, both the sensitivity and the maximal response to the phenol are significantly enhanced in the presence of sugar and low pH (Chang and Winans, 1992). The Initial Steps in Agrobacterium Tumefaciens Pathogenesis 225 Even more mechanistically interesting are the broad structural requirements within many of these molecular classes. Even though the sugar response requires reducing hexoses, several of the hexose diastereomers mediate similar responses. Even more remarkable, almost 70 different phenols have been reported to be active inducers (Palmer et al. While ortho-methoxy substituents do enhance activity, many other substitutions on the ring are compatible with the inducing activity. Therefore, not only is the response to many different classes of signal molecules a hallmark of Agrobacterium pathogenicity, but within each structural class, a broad range of structures can be accommodated to mediate the response. A logical hypothesis is that the presence of all the signals at some specific location, and/or developmental state, indicates an organ, tissue or cell type that is maximally susceptible to the pathogen. We do know that, for example, root exudates, conditioned culture medium and extracts of seedlings and plants are sources of vir inducing signals. An example of what might be occurring in relation to the vir inducing phenols is reflected in the composition of lignin during development of some plants. In many cases, the relative ratio of monomethoxy- (guaicyl) vs dimethoxy- (syringyl) phenols found in lignin varies significantly within different developmental stages of the plant (Dixon et al. This diversity is likely to reflect the availability of the phenolic monomers that are used in the biosynthesis of this polymer rather than post-polymerization modification of the constituents.

Pulse-chase experiments in the same study revealed that when only mildly expressed, the apo-protein does not accumulate in the cell at all, but is rapidly degraded by proteases. A number of other proteins, in both eukaryotes and bacteria, have been identified that require their cognate ligands for protein folding and stability against proteolysis (Dyson and Wright, 2002). In most cases, these proteins are involved in highly time-dependent processes (such as regulation of transcription). It is also possible that incorporation of ligand into the protein folding process results in an increase in specificity of binding (Dyson and Wright, 2002). The origin of transfer of the conjugation system (oriT) is also located in the intergenic region between the two tra operons, specifically between tra box I and traA (Zhu et al. The TraC and TraD proteins are thought to be accessory proteins that may form a complex with TraA and enhance its function at oriT (Farrand et al. RepA and RepB are thought to be involved in plasmid partitioning (Williams and Thomas, 1992; Moller-Jensen et al. RepC is strictly required for vegetative replication (Li and Farrand, 2000; Pappas and Winans, 2003a, 2003b). An additional small gene, repD, has recently been identified, and lies in the intergenic region between repA and repB (Chai and Winans, 2005b).
